Frequently Asked Questions about the 76190 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 76190?

There are currently 4 Studio Apartments in 76190 with rent ranges from $2,100 to $1,860 with an average price of $1,262.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 76190 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 76190 ranges from $670 to $11,818 with an average monthly rent of $1,425.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 76190 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 76190 range from $1,200 to $4,895.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,645.

How expensive are 76190 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 76190 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,395 to $6,706 - averaging $2,192 for the location.
